Runbook: Meridix calendar sync. When Huddlewick events duplicate after a release, the conflict resolver in Parlane has fallen behind. Check lag on the sync queue; anything over 500 events means resolver pods crashed on malformed recurrence rules. Drain the poison queue, restart pods in order (resolver, then fetcher), and replay from the last checkpoint. Replay requires elevated access to the Parlane ops endpoint, so use the service key below.

app token of badug-tahaf = qvz11-nP5FBNr8qnh

/*
 * Shipping-fee rules engine for the Mossbarrel storefront.
 *
 * Welcome aboard. This module evaluates fee rules in priority order:
 * zone surcharges first, then weight brackets, then promotional waivers.
 * Rules are loaded once at startup and cached; don't add per-request
 * lookups here. If you change a bracket boundary, update the fixtures
 * in the regression suite too, or the Hollowfen CI job will fail.
 * The engine's tuning constants are defined immediately below.
 */

tuning constants:
QUOTAS = {
    "druwyn": 5,
    "holix": 5,
    "zorath": 5,
    "holwyn": 10,
}

Welcome to Larchgate. New starters: the guest Wi-Fi desk at reception is for visitors only — don't point your own devices at it. Your corporate network details arrive on day one from IT. If you're setting up a visitor before then, the reception desk terminal unlocks with the pass code below.

turnstile pass: bdg-TXR-4

## Configuration

Welcome to the Fernledger profile-store team. Sharding is controlled by `SHARD_COUNT` (currently 16 — never change without a migration plan) and `SHARD_RING_SEED`. Routing uses consistent hashing on user handle; see `ring.go`. Local dev runs a single shard with `SHARD_COUNT=1`. The shard coordinator requires an auth credential in your env file, placed on the next line:

sealed setting: VAULT_KEY20=c8ea1e419912889df6b4